    Rick Redig-Tackman (born July 2, 2000) is an American professional stock car racing driver who last competed part-time in the ARCA Menards Series, driving the No. 31 Chevrolet for Rise Motorsports. Racing career

    Rick Tackman Jr. (born November 11, 1975) is an American professional stock car racing driver who has competed in the ARCA Racing Series from 2000 to 2017. He is the father of fellow racing driver Rick Redig-Tackman, who has also competed in what is now known as the ARCA Menards Series.

    The family postponed the funeral from December 15 to December 18, so that more could attend, [77] and the service took place at the City Auditorium in Macon. More than 4,500 people came to the funeral, overflowing the 3,000-seat hall. Redding was entombed at his ranch in Round Oak, about twenty miles (30 km) north of Macon. [89]
